Selecting the Ideal Metal Roof Coating for Long-Lasting Protection
Identifying the most suitable coating for your metal roof is essential for maximizing durability and effectiveness. Several considerations impact this selection, including environmental conditions, roofing angle, and particular structural requirements. Top-grade solutions, such as polyurethane, silicone, or acrylic, offer significant benefits. Silicone-based coatings deliver outstanding waterproofing and UV resistance, making them well-suited for locations prone to significant rainfall. Acrylic-based coatings are known for their energy efficiency and reflectivity, which can reduce cooling costs. Polyurethane-based solutions deliver outstanding resistance to wear and durability, making them perfect for areas with significant foot traffic.
Furthermore, adequate surface preparation is essential for adhesion and long-lasting performance. One should consider selecting coatings with a well-established reputation in commercial roofing applications. Confirming compatibility with the existing roofing system will also improve the longevity of the roofing structure. In the end, the optimal selection will correspond to particular environmental factors and performance standards, guaranteeing a long-lasting, budget-friendly solution for commercial metal roofing systems.

Essential Surface Preparation Guidelines
Proper surface preparation is critical to the successful application of roof coatings. The process commences with a detailed inspection to locate any damage, rust, or contaminants on the metal roof. Surface cleaning is essential; using a pressure washer or appropriate cleaning solution removes dirt, grease, and existing coatings that may hinder adhesion. Following the cleaning process, the roof should be left to dry entirely. Additionally, handling any rust spots with a quality rust-inhibiting primer assists in preventing ongoing deterioration. Moreover, addressing repairs to seams or flashing should be completed to secure a smooth and uniform surface. Ultimately, verifying that the surface is clear of moisture and contaminants will extend the lifespan and effectiveness of the applied roof coatings.
Overview of Application Techniques
Correctly carrying out the application of roof coatings necessitates a methodical approach to ensure maximum effectiveness and long-term results. First, confirm that the surface is dry, clean, and free from debris, as this improves adhesion. After that, identify the correct coating type based on the metal roof's specific requirements. It is beneficial to use a primer if necessary, improving the bonding process. When applying the coating, employ even strokes with a sprayer, roller, or brush, guaranteeing uniform coverage. Focus particularly on seams and edges, where leaks are likely to occur. Several thin layers are typically preferred over one thick coat, as they promote superior adhesion and more effective drying. The Drying and Curing Process
Curing and drying are fundamental steps in the application of roof coatings, impacting both durability and effectiveness. Throughout the curing stage, chemical reactions occur that bond the coating to the substrate, improving adhesion and protection against environmental elements. This stage typically requires ideal temperature and humidity levels, which should be monitored closely to guarantee proper curing.
Evaporation, by comparison, refers to the evaporation of solvents, allowing the application to harden. Variables such as ventilation, thickness of application, and surrounding conditions can significantly affect drying time. It is important to prevent foot traffic or exposure to moisture during both stages to avoid imperfections. Following manufacturer guidelines ensures the longevity and effectiveness of the coating on the roof.
Key Maintenance Tips to Prolong Your Metal Roof Coating's Lifespan
Preserving a metal roof coating is essential for optimizing its durability and effectiveness. Routine inspections are a key factor; property owners should check for signs of wear, such as peeling, cracking, or discoloration. Periodically cleaning the surface helps prevent the buildup of dirt and debris, which can trap moisture and lead to corrosion. Employing a mild detergent with a soft brush or light pressure wash is suggested for thorough cleaning that preserves the coating.
